Purpose of the role

Support the QHSE Manager and wider business in ensuring that all Health, Safety and Environmental matters are dealt with quickly, efficiently and in line with legislation and best practice.

Review and create risk assessments and safe systems of work.

Manage and coordinate the monthly internal QHSE meeting, ensuring all related stats and KPIs are fully accurate and up to date.

Champion the Health and Safety agenda throughout the site and wider network, identifying opportunities to share best practise and discuss common issues or challenges.

Via proactive engagement with all stakeholders, ensure that our H&S systems support and align with our products and services so that they meet the expectations of our customers at all times, whilst maintaining high standards of safety with the aim of continual improvement and striving for zero accidents.

Key tasks & Responsibilities

Providing advice on H&S related legislation, Approved Codes of Practice, relevant British Standards etc

Supporting the deployment of company H&S initiatives

Leading the daily management process for H&S

Auditing against CRH Standards

Supporting the business with H&S related improvement projects (e.g. LOTTO

Developing new systems or processes in

Auditing against ISO 45001

Facilitation of risk assessment and SOP developments

Delivery of H&S related training

Assist in delivery of H&S related training including new starter inductions

Ensure all H&S maintenance records are properly maintained in line with statutory and management system requirements

Assist maintenance in contractor control activities including pre qualification, assessment of RAMS packs, completing contractor inductions, completion of permits to work and spot checks of contractor activities as required

Actively liaise with the purchasing and goods inwards teams to ensure adequate monitoring of suppliers, quality of incoming raw materials and address raw material non-conformances in timely fashion

Arranging and coordinating of ongoing health screening of the workforce including occupational health checks, vibration monitoring, prescription eyewear etc

Assist other members of the team and production front line leaders in day to day maintenance of health & safety and environmental management systems including aiding production of risk assessments and safe systems of work

Assist during third party audits, leading audits where required

Develop H&S requirements including risk assessments or safe systems of work involved with the project

Liaise with other Leviat UK sites to maintain system alignment, perform audits of the sites and to ensure shared best practices. (This will include occasional travel to other sites)

Key Competencies & Relevant Experience

Attention to detail/systematic approach

Flexible and adaptable

Ability to multi-task

Excellent communication skills

Ability to influence and engage stakeholders in adhering to new and existing protocols

Essential

NEBOSH Diploma or equivalent

Experience in working in manufacturing sector

Experience and working knowledge ISO45001

Qualification in internal auditing

Competent in MS Office suite.

Ability to work on multiple tasks and work cross-functionally to identify issues and implement solutions and improvements

Experience of RCFA techniques eg: “5 why”, “fishbone diagrams” etc.

Desirable

Experience of working in a metal fabrication environment

Qualification in lead auditing

Understanding of Lean processes

Practical experience of implementing SHE systems, performing risk assessments, producing safe systems of work etc

Knowledge of waste streams, energy conservation and environmental management principles
